Bearcat basketball moves up to No. 10 in NABC Top 25

The Northwest Missouri State men’s basketball jumped two spots to No. 10 in the latest National Association of Basketball Coaches Top 25 released Tuesday.

The Bearcats move into the top 10 after jumping out to an 8-0 start on the season. The Bearcats are coming off a blowout win over Nebraska-Kearney and an overtime win against Lindenwood in last week’s action.

West Liberty (W. Va.) holds onto the top spot in the NABC rankings for the fourth straight grabbing 12 first place votes. The only other MIAA team represented in the top 25, Washburn, checks in at No. 2 and received one first place vote.

Metro State (Colo.) follows the Ichabods at No. 3 with Alabama-Huntsville at No. 4 and Bellarmine (Ky.) at No. 5. All three schools also received one first place vote.

Defending champion, Western Washington checks in at No. 6, followed by Southern Indiana at No. 7 and Cal Poly Pomona at No. 8. Rounding out the top 10 ahead of the Bearcats is Seattle Pacific at No. 9 with Northwest sitting at No. 10.

Northwest returns to the hardwood after finals week with tournament action at the Hawaii Classic Saturday and Sunday. The Bearcats face off with St. Edward’s Saturday and close out tournament action Sunday evening against Harding.
